Crans-Montana, switzerland -⁢ Swiss mountain biker Alessandra Koller‍ enters⁢ her first elite World Cup race on Saturday, September 14, 2024, as a medal ⁤contender, marking a career high point after navigating notable challenges. The⁤ 28-year-old’s ascent to the top has been fueled by ⁤recent strategic additions to her training regimen.

Koller’s journey to this moment hasn’t been linear. After periods of struggle,a late-2023 collaboration with a mental trainer and a ⁢South African coach ⁣proved pivotal. Thes partnerships⁣ provided “the right ⁣refreshment⁣ for the head,” according to Koller, and represent ⁣key components in⁣ her current success. The upcoming ‍World Cup in Crans-Montana offers a significant opportunity for Koller to ⁢demonstrate her progress on home soil.

Viewers can⁤ watch the women’s WM-Cross-Country race live on SRF Info starting ⁣at 1:30 p.m.on Saturday, with the⁤ race commencing at 2:00 p.m. Koller’s performance will be closely watched as she aims to capitalize on her recent gains and compete for a ⁤medal.
